A multimodal benchmark for dynamic mathematical reasoning over visual and structured inputs.
As of March 2026, Qwen3.6 Plus leads the DynaMath leaderboard with 88.0% , followed by GPT-5.2 (86.8%) and Qwen3.5 397B (86.3%).

According to BenchLM.ai, Qwen3.6 Plus leads the DynaMath benchmark with a score of 88.0%, followed by GPT-5.2 (86.8%) and Qwen3.5 397B (86.3%). The top models are clustered within 1.7 points, suggesting this benchmark is nearing saturation for frontier models.
6 models have been evaluated on DynaMath. The benchmark falls in the Multimodal & Grounded category. This category carries a 12% weight in BenchLM.ai's overall scoring system. DynaMath is currently displayed for reference but excluded from the scoring formula, so it does not directly affect overall rankings.

DynaMath is intended to probe whether models can track changing mathematical structure in multimodal settings rather than solving static text-only equations.
